The formula for determining the number of diagonals in a shape is n(n-3)/2 where n=vertices, (corners or intersections of geometric shapes). For an eight sided shape we replace n with 8. 8(8-3)/2 8(5)/2 (8x5)/2 40/2=20 An octagon contains 20 diagonals. For a further example we can determine the diagonals in a shape with 5 sides: 5(5-3)/2 5(2)/2 (5x2)/2 10/2=5 A Pentagon contains 5 diagonals.
